How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Alachua County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Alachua County Studio Apartments | $1,448 | $800 | $3,481 |
| Alachua County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,441 | $795 | $3,768 |
| Alachua County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,592 | $739 | $4,087 |
| Alachua County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,763 | $586 | $10,000+ |
| Alachua County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,062 | $495 | $10,000+ |
| Alachua County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,604 | $829 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Alachua County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Alachua County?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Alachua County is at University Terrace West listed at $440.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Alachua County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Alachua County is $1,521.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Alachua County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Alachua County is a 3,100 square feet unit starting from $829 at The Ridge.
What is the average size for Alachua County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Alachua County is currently at 781 sq ft.
